The term “Cloud 9 liquid incense” is often mentioned in discussions around synthetic incense products that are sold in small bottles and marketed as aromatherapy or incense liquids. Despite the name, these products are widely discussed in connection with synthetic cannabinoids, which are lab-made chemicals designed to mimic the effects of THC (the active compound in cannabis).

What Is “Cloud 9 Liquid Incense”?

“Cloud 9” is a name that has been used in various informal markets to describe a type of liquid incense or herbal spray product. These products are often:

  • Sold as aromatic liquids or incense sprays
  • Marketed for “relaxation” or “scent use”
  • Associated in reports with synthetic chemical compounds

In many cases, such products are not traditional incense but may contain synthetic cannabinoids, which are chemically engineered substances designed to act on the same brain receptors as cannabis.

Health and Safety Risks

Research and public health reports have linked synthetic incense-type products with several risks:

1. Unpredictable Effects

Unlike regulated substances, synthetic compounds may vary significantly in strength and composition.

2. Possible Health Effects

Reported effects in some cases include:

  • Anxiety or panic reactions
  • Rapid heart rate
  • Confusion or disorientation
  • Nausea or vomiting
  • Severe adverse reactions in some cases

3. Lack of Quality Control

Because these products are often unregulated, there is no consistent standard for:

  • Ingredients
  • Dosage accuracy
  • Manufacturing safety

Legal Status

The legal status of products marketed as “liquid incense” or similar names varies by country, but in many regions:

  • Synthetic cannabinoids are controlled or banned substances
  • Products containing them may be considered illegal regardless of branding
  • Authorities often update laws to cover new chemical variants

In India and many other countries, regulations around synthetic drugs are strict, and possession or distribution of such substances can lead to legal consequences.
